Python Kod Örnekleri,

Python Kod Örnekleri: Başlangıçtan İleri Seviyeye Yolculuk

Python Kod Örnekleri: Python, sade ve okunabilir söz dizimi ile yazılım dünyasında hızla yükselen bir programlama dili haline gelmiştir. Böylece karmaşık yapılarla boğuşmadan işlevsel uygulamalar geliştirebilme imkânı sunan Python, hem yazılıma yeni adım atanlar hem de deneyimli geliştiriciler için güçlü bir araçtır. Öğrenmesi kolay yapısı, açık kaynaklı olması ve büyük bir topluluk tarafından desteklenmesi sayesinde kısa sürede küresel çapta yaygınlaşmıştır. Bugün pek çok üniversite Python’u temel programlama dili olarak öğretmekte, dünya çapında dev şirketler projelerinde Python’u tercih etmektedir.

Python yalnızca başlangıç seviyesindeki geliştiriciler için değil; aynı zamanda veri bilimi, yapay zeka, makine öğrenimi, web geliştirme, oyun programlama, siber güvenlik ve otomasyon gibi birçok profesyonel alanda da kullanılmaktadır. Geniş kütüphane ekosistemi sayesinde neredeyse her ihtiyaca yönelik hazır çözümler sunar. Örneğin; pandas ve numpy veri analizi için, tensorflow ve scikit-learn yapay zeka projeleri için, flask ve django ise web uygulamaları geliştirmek için tercih edilir.

Bu blog yazısında, Python öğrenmeye yeni başlayanlardan ileri düzey projeler üzerinde çalışanlara kadar geniş bir yelpazeye hitap edecek şekilde hazırlanmış, pratik Python kod örnekleri paylaşacağız. Amacımız, bu örneklerle hem temel konuları pekiştirmenize yardımcı olmak hem de kendi projelerinizi geliştirmeniz için ilham kaynağı sunmak. Hazırsanız Python’un büyüleyici dünyasına birlikte adım atalım!

1. Yeni Başlayanlar İçin Basit Python Kod Örnekleri

Merhaba Dünya!

python
print("Merhaba, Dünya!")

Bu klasik örnek, Python’daki ilk adımı atmak için idealdir. print() fonksiyonu sayesinde ekrana metin yazdırabilirsiniz.

Kullanıcıdan Veri Alma

python
isim = input("Adınızı girin: ")
print(f"Merhaba, {isim}!")

input() fonksiyonu ile kullanıcıdan veri alabilir, f-string ile bu veriyi dinamik olarak kullanabilirsiniz.

2. Orta Seviye Python Kod Örnekleri

Fibonacci Dizisi

python
def fibonacci(n):
a, b = 0, 1
for _ in range(n):
print(a, end=' ')
a, b = b, a + b

fibonacci(10)

Bu örnek, döngüler ve değişken atamaları konusunda fikir verir. Özellikle Fibonacci dizisi genellikle algoritma mantığını öğrenmek isteyenler için iyi bir başlangıçtır.

Liste Elemanlarını Filtreleme

python
sayilar = [1, 2, 3, 4, 5, 6, 7, 8, 9]
tek_sayilar = list(filter(lambda x: x % 2 != 0, sayilar))
print(tek_sayilar)

Fonksiyonel programlamaya geçiş yapmak isteyenler için filter() ve lambda fonksiyonları oldukça kullanışlıdır.

3. İleri Seviye Python Kod Örnekleri

Basit Bir Web Scraper

python
import requests
from bs4 import BeautifulSoup

url = "https://example.com"
response = requests.get(url)
soup = BeautifulSoup(response.text, "html.parser")

basliklar = soup.find_all("h2")
for baslik in basliklar:
print(baslik.text)

Web scraping, Python’un gücünü gerçek dünyada gösterdiği alanlardan biridir. Bu örnek, temel bir haber sitesinden başlık çekmenizi sağlar.

SQLite ile Basit Veritabanı İşlemleri

python
import sqlite3

conn = sqlite3.connect("veritabani.db")
cursor = conn.cursor()

cursor.execute("CREATE TABLE IF NOT EXISTS kisiler (isim TEXT, yas INTEGER)")
cursor.execute("INSERT INTO kisiler VALUES (?, ?)", ("Ahmet", 30))
conn.commit()

cursor.execute("SELECT * FROM kisiler")
print(cursor.fetchall())

conn.close()

Veritabanı yönetimi, neredeyse her projede ihtiyaç duyulan bir beceridir. SQLite, bu konuda öğrenilmesi en kolay sistemlerden biridir.

Yukarıda paylaştığımız Python kod örnekleri, hem temel kavramları pekiştirmek isteyenler için harika bir başlangıç noktası sunuyor. Özellikle Python’un sade yapısı ve basit otomasyon script’lerinden karmaşık yapay zeka projelerine kadar çok çeşitli uygulamalar geliştirmek mümkündür. Üstelik bu örnekler aynı zamanda sizi gerçek dünya problemlerine çözüm üretmeye teşvik eder.

Kod yazarken karşılaşacağınız her küçük başarı, sizi bir adım daha ileri taşıyacak. Python’un sunduğu özgürlükle, öğrenmeyi keyifli hale getirip, kendi projelerinizi hayata geçirebilirsiniz. Eğer yazılım dünyasında sağlam bir temel atmak, istiyorsanız, şimdi tam zamanı! Klavyenizi hazırlayın, Python’un esnek dünyasında ilk satırınızı yazın ve öğrenmenin heyecanını keşfedin.

Loading

Bir yanıt yazın

E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ir